Mayfest
May 11, 2024
Here comes the 43rd Anniversary of Mayfest coordinated by The Rotary Club of Bluffton! Featuring more than 130 artists and food vendors.
Get ready for an outstanding event featuring local and regional arts and crafts, great music, and delectable local foods up and down the street, our hilarious Ugly Dog contest and the messy, funny, pie eating contest. This year’s featured artist is Lauren Terrett.
Historic Bluffton Arts & Seafood Festival
October 12–20, 2024
The award-winning Annual Bluffton Arts and Seafood Festival is a weeklong event offering a myriad of activities, showcasing the locally harvested seafood, delicious Lowcountry cuisine, rich history, culture and art of the area and Southern hospitality found only in Bluffton.
The highlight of the festival has always been the Street Fest and will be held Saturday October 19th & Sunday October 20th.
Palmetto Bluff’s April Artist in Residence
April 24–27, 2024
Don’t miss out on Palmetto Bluff’s April Artist in Residence, Kurtis Schumm! This “Master of All” has found success in the music, culinary, and fine art industries. Kurtis has pioneered a unique “painting backward” technique using clear acrylic canvases blended with ink and acrylics.
